Chapter 13: KSX II Local Console

253

Note: Keyboard use for Chinese, Japanese, and Korean is for
display only. Local language input is not supported at this time for
KSX II Local Console functions.

3. Choose the local port hotkey. The local port hotkey is used to return

to the KSX II Local Console interface when a target server interface
is being viewed. The default is to Double Click Scroll Lock, but you
can select any key combination from the drop-down list:

Hot key:

Take this action:

Double Click Scroll Lock

Press Scroll Lock key twice quickly

Double Click Num Lock

Press Num Lock key twice quickly

Double Click Caps Lock

Press Caps Lock key twice quickly

Double Click Left Alt key

Press the left Alt key twice quickly

Double Click Left Shift key

Press the left Shift key twice quickly

Double Click Left Ctrl key

Press the left Ctrl key twice quickly

4. Set the Video Switching Delay from between 0 - 5 seconds, if

necessary. Generally 0 is used unless more time is needed (certain
monitors require more time to switch the video).

5. If you would like to use the power save feature:

a. Select the Power Save Mode checkbox.

b. Set the amount of time (in minutes) in which Power Save Mode

will be initiated.

6. Choose the resolution for the KSX II Local Console from the

drop-down list:

 800x600

 1024x768

 1280x1024

7. Choose the refresh rate from the drop-down list:

 60 Hz

 75 Hz

8. Choose the type of local user authentication:

 Local/LDAP/RADIUS. This is the recommended option. For more

information about authentication, see

Remote Authentication

(on page 34).

 None. There is no authentication for Local Console access. This

option is recommended for secure environments only.

9. Select the "Ignore CC managed mode on local port" checkbox if you

would like local user access to the KSX II even when the device is
under CC-SG management.
